Who Is Conservation International?
- Conservation International (or CI) is a non–profit organization that seeks to protect unique and threatened ecosystems around the globe.
- Building upon a strong foundation of science, partnership and field demonstration, CI empowers societies to responsibly and sustainably care for nature for the well-being of humanity.
- CI’s work occurs in more than 45 countries, primarily in developing nations in Africa, Asia, Oceania, and the Central and South American rainforests.
What is the “Protect an Acre” Program?
- Around the world, 32 million acres of tropical forests are lost every year – accelerating the rate of species loss and devastating surrounding communities. In response, CI initiated the "Protect an Acre" program.
- "Protect an Acre" allows individuals to protect the world’s threatened tropical forests one acre at a time.
